III operating and requirements of air-powered FRL combination
Note: If the air source is not clean, the seal system of air-powered components such as air pressure
regulating valve, cylinder, reversing valve and so on can be damaged easily.
3.1 Air-powered FRL combination
Air-powered FRL combination is an important and indispensable component which consists of air filter,
pressure reducing valve and oil atomizer (as shown in Figure 1) its roles as follows:
3.1.1 Air filter: It can filter most water brought by the air compressor in air-producing process and keep the
water in the cup under the filter.
3.1.2Reducing valve: Rotating the handle after pulling the regulator handle upward forcibly, and clockwise
rotation for the pressurization, anti-clockwise rotation for the decompression; it is recommended to set the
pressure at 0.50.8MPa, depending on the ambience and the path length; push the handle up to the
original protective position after regulate the pressure to the necessary pressure by observe the
barometer.
3.1.3 Air Atomizer: The lubricant in oil cup of the air atomizer will flow to all air-powered parts to
complement the lubricant with the flow of air.
3.2 .The operating requirements of the air-powered FRL combination are as follows:
3.2.1. Water drainage should be did expelled every day if the cup at the bottom of the air filter has water,
the steps are as follows: the water in the cup can be discharged by cutting off the main air source of the air
compressor, evacuating air in the equipment and unscrew the knob at the bottom of the water cup of the
air filter when the barometer being zero on the pressure reducing valve, tighten the knob after the water
being drained thoroughly.
Warning: If there is possibility that the water may contact with the electrical parts when water drainage,
it is important to use containers to catch the water to avoid personal harm.
3.2.2 The oil cup at the bottom of the oil atomizer is used to store lubricant, to add lubricant there are two
methods. First, remove the oil and put it back after it was filled; second, fill lubricant through the oil hole at
the top of the oil atomizer.
Note: The lubricant being added can be general 22#engine oil, but it must clean and free of impurities.
22# turbine oil is preferable, which must be clean.
